In the paper, unique interdependences of?financial literacy, fintech use, and the impact of these mediators on the banking sector performance are stressed. This research gives closer attention to the influence of the use of fintech technologies and the development of financial literacy on the?efficiency and effectiveness of the banking institutions and their financial performance and security. The study design is strong as well, based on rigorous investigation methodology,?and comprehensive review of the literature. The use of both quantitative and qualitative?data methods and multiple data sources contribute to a rigorous methodological approach to an in-depth analysis of the issue. Among the key findings are enhanced service delivery,?cost efficiency, and increased customer engagement as a positive result of the fintech penetration on performance of the banking sector. And it underscores the need for financial literacy programs in building customer confidence and the?frictionless adoption of fintech innovation into everyday business processes. The thesis thoroughly analyzes several challenges and limitations, adopting a subtle perspective on the complex issues surrounding the integration of fintech and advancing financial literacy within the banking sector. This research has real-world implications for banking institutions and policymakers, and it adds useful information to ongoing financial industry discourse. In summary, this thesis promotes further research and discussion by being a significant contribution to the evolving intersection of technology, finance, and education.
